Salt water, vinegar, bronze, air, and beach sand are all mixtures, some of them more homogeneous or heterogeneous than others. A mixture, as the name itself says, is a blend of more than one element. So salt water is a mixture of salt and water, vinegar is a mixture of acetic acid and water, bronze is a mixture of copper and other metals, air is a mixture of nitrogen, oxygen, and other elements, and beach sand is a mixture of sand and water.
The field of behavioral genetics is devoted to the study of just how much of personality is due to inherited traits.
The study of how genes and environment affect behavior is known as behavioral genetics. More knowledge about how the environment affects behavior can be gained by looking at genetic influence. The study of the nature and causes of behavioral differences between individuals is the main objective of behavioral genetics. Only a few of the many different methodological approaches are used in behavioral genetic research. Genes are passed down to us, not behavior or personality. Additionally, these genes contain instructions for making proteins, which can come together in a variety of ways and influence our behavior. Variation in aptitude and talent across various fields of intellectual, creative, and athletic abilities is largely influenced by genetic factors.
